Solution Overview
Problem
Existing information handling systems face challenges in efficiently managing maintenance operations, leading to potential data loss and prolonged downtime due to manual synchronization and lack of real-time awareness across management stations, especially in virtualization environments.
Innovation Solution
A virtualization aware server maintenance mode is introduced, where a virtualization manager automatically tracks and communicates maintenance activities, reducing downtime and manual intervention by synchronizing maintenance operations across systems.

In accordance with the present disclosure, a system and method are herein disclosed for providing a virtualization aware server maintenance mode. In one embodiment, an event is triggered in when a system action request is received by an information handling system. The event is processed and the hypervisor is placed in maintenance mode. The virtualization manager is notified that the mode of the hypervisor has changed and the virtualization manager stores the information associated with the mode status change. The virtualization manager may also notify other remote access consoles or virtualization managers of the mode status change of the hypervisor. A maintenance mode lock may be acquired when the hypervisor is placed in maintenance mode and released after the system action has been processed.
